William and Catherine share new family portrait for 15th wedding anniversary

10 articles · Updated · BBC.com · Apr 29
  • The photo, taken by Matt Porteous in Cornwall during Easter, features the couple with Prince George, Princess Charlotte, Prince Louis, and their dog.
  • The image was posted on social media with a heart emoji and the caption 'Celebrating 15 years of marriage.'
  • William and Catherine married in 2011 at Westminster Abbey and have three children, having met at the University of St Andrews.
